What is the Chicago Booth Scholars Program?

The Chicago Booth Scholars (CBS) Program is a unique opportunity specifically designed for students completing their senior year of undergraduate studies. How does it work? You apply to Chicago Booth’s MBA through the CBS Program during your senior year and defer admission for two to five years as you begin your professional career journey. Enjoy the added benefit of an expanded business network right out of college, and then when you are ready to continue your education, start your MBA studies at Booth in our Full-Time, Evening, or Weekend MBA program.

So, why should you consider becoming a Chicago Booth Scholar?

With the opportunity to defer for two to five years, you have the added flexibility to explore different career opportunities that’ll help shape your post-MBA goals before officially enrolling at Chicago Booth. In addition to providing the autonomy to explore different career options, our deferred MBA program offers you access to Chicago Booth’s extensive network of remarkable resources, such as networking events, student-run activities, and faculty-led programs—all before even starting at Booth.

Another unique perk associated with the CBS Program is the ability to choose between enrolling in the Full-Time or Part-Time MBA Programs. It truly maximizes the flexibility of your deferred MBA and ensures you are pursuing the best professional path for you. The Full-Time MBA Program is a great fit for those looking to fully immerse themselves in the classroom experience daily in order to build upon one’s academic and professional skill set. The Part-Time MBA Program is perfect for those who wish to continue working while simultaneously taking courses to learn more about their particular field of interest.

Booth Scholars also receive the added benefit of having the $250 application fee waived. We welcome undergraduate students with any major, background, and interests to apply for this life-changing opportunity. For consideration, submit your application by the deadline of April 29, 2025.
